Actress and dancer Khabonina Qubeka has apologised for her “irresponsible” post on X following the news of musician Bulelwa “Zahara” Mkutukana’s death.

MINISTER CONFIRMS ZAHARA’S PASSING

The Loliwe hitmaker is said to have passed away on Monday, 11 December, at a private hospital in Johannesburg after she was admitted almost three weeks ago.

News of her passing were announced by the SABC on social media, but the public broadcaster later deleted the post. Zizi Kodwa – who is the minister of sports, arts and culture – later confirmed the news and extended his condolences to the Mkutukana family.

“I am very saddened by the passing of Zahara. My deepest condolences to the Mkutukana family and the South African music industry. Government has been with the family for some time now. Zahara and her guitar made an incredible and lasting impact in South African music,” Kodwa wrote.

However, her family have not released a statement yet.

KHABONINA APOLOGISES

This has caused confusion among fans, with others claiming she may still be alive. Amid the confusion, Shaka Ilembe star Khabonina also joined in to pay tribute to the singer. However, minutes later, she claimed Zahara was still alive and wished her a speedy recovery.

“Jan neh the #Hashtags & “full reports” will give us heart attacks! SHES ALIVE. #GetWellSoonZAHARA, ” Khabonina wrote.

The former Muvhango actress’ post quickly garnered reactions from fans, prompting her to delete it and apologise.

“Ja noh… X played me today… walked right into it! Apologies fam! As I walk away,” Khabonina said.

She further said to a fan: “Apologies lala, heard she’s not dead after the rip hashtag. That was irresponsible of me.”
